"Oshikatsu Jihanki" (Fandom Vending Machine) for Easy Live Ticket Purchases Appears at Yokohama Station HAMAB2

Pia Corporation and Pro Relation Inc. have installed the "Oshikatsu Jihanki" at Yokohama Station's HAMAB2 to offer live tickets, starting with "JANET・JACKSON JAPAN 2026" on May 2, 2026. This initiative aims to provide accessible entertainment and new artist encounters for station users.

Pia Corporation (Headquarters: Shibuya-ku, Tokyo, Representative: Hiroshi Yanai) and Pro Relation Inc. (Headquarters: Shinagawa-ku, Tokyo, Representative: Honoka Nozaki) will start selling tickets for "JANET・JACKSON JAPAN 2026" at the "Oshikatsu Jihanki" (Fandom Vending Machine), where live tickets can be easily purchased, from 5:00 PM on May 2, 2026, located in the north-south passageway on the second basement floor of Yokohama Station (Tokyu Toyoko Line / Minatomirai Line) at "HAMA B2".

This is a new initiative aimed at creating an environment where people can easily access entertainment within their daily routines, such as at a train station.

Coinciding with the Japan performances of global pop icon Janet Jackson, "JANET・JACKSON JAPAN 2026" (June 13 (Sat) and June 14 (Sun) at K-Arena Yokohama, Kanagawa Prefecture), a vending machine where live tickets can be purchased on the spot will appear in the north-south passageway on the second basement floor of Yokohama Station (Tokyu Toyoko Line / Minatomirai Line) at "HAMA B2"!

● A new ticket purchasing experience available at the station

It is possible to easily encounter live event information during daily commutes, school runs, or shopping, and purchase tickets on the spot.

For those who happen to stop by, it will create new encounters with artists they didn't know before, broadening their music experience.

● Creating experiences that connect artists and the city

The "Oshikatsu Jihanki" not only sells tickets but also functions as a "city media" that disseminates artist visuals and information. It expands opportunities for fan interaction as a new information touchpoint in the station space and creates an experience where people can immerse themselves in the artist's world within the city.

Furthermore, in the future, we are considering further expansion of music and "Oshikatsu" experiences, such as handling artist-related goods and limited-edition items, proposing multifaceted ways to enjoy beyond just ticket purchases. *Please note that details regarding merchandise sales for this performance are currently undecided.

■ Installation Overview

Installation Location: North-south passageway on the second basement floor of Yokohama Station (Tokyu Toyoko Line / Minatomirai Line) at "HAMA B2"

Exhibition Period: Scheduled from May 2, 2026 (Saturday) to June 12, 2026 (Friday)

Ticket Details:
- June 13, 2026 (Saturday) 6:00 PM start (4:30 PM doors open) [Special Guest] Shingo Katori
- June 14, 2026 (Sunday) 5:00 PM start (3:30 PM doors open) [Opening Act] BE:FIRST

S seat: 1 single ticket including tax ¥22,000, 2 pair tickets including tax ¥44,000

Seller: Ticket Pia

Available Payment Methods: PayPay, iD, QUICPay+, d払い (d Pay), Rakuten Pay, au PAY, Smart Code, AEON Pay, Alipay, WeChat Pay, WAON, nanaco, Rakuten Edy

*Cash cannot be used. Payment services with a fixed security amount, such as credit cards, cannot be used.

No refunds are possible except in case of performance cancellation. Pre-school children are not permitted to enter.
